The contract requires the design, review, and certification of hazard warning labels for benzocaine gel to ensure full compliance with OSHA’s Hazard Communication Standard and DFARS regulations. This work must be completed prior to contract award and is intended to support the safe handling, storage, and transportation of the pharmaceutical product within federal supply chains. The effort involves developing accurate, legally compliant labeling that reflects the chemical hazards of benzocaine gel, including appropriate signal words, pictograms, hazard statements, and precautionary measures, all aligned with mandated federal safety frameworks. This subcontract is issued under NAICS code 541620, indicating professional, scientific, and technical services related to design and compliance, and is managed by the Department of Defense through the Medical Supply Chain Pharm FSA. The place of performance is designated as FPO with ZIP code 96667, indicating a military mail address likely associated with overseas or secure operations. Responses are due by May 18, 2026, with the solicitation posted on May 11, 2026, and all submissions must be made through the DIBBS platform. No set-aside provisions are specified, and the work is critical to maintaining regulatory adherence across DoD medical supply pathways.
